通用数据权限的思考与设计2019-04-18阅读 54401、数据权限概述1.1、什么是数据权限?如果想学习Java工程化、高性能及分布式、深入浅出。微服务、Spring,MyBatis,Netty源码分析的朋友可以加我的Java高级交流:787707172,群里有阿里大牛直播讲解技术,以及Java大型互联网技术的视频免费分享给大家。数据权限是指对系统用户进行数据资源可见性的控制,通俗的
转载 2023-07-19 15:14:34
188阅读
权限设计的最终目标就是定义每个用户可以在系统中做哪些事情。 当我们谈到权限的时候,一般可以分为 功能权限数据权限和字段权限;功能权限:用户具有哪些权利,比如特定单据的增、删、改、查、审批、反审批等等;一般按照一个人在组织内的工作内容来划分;比如一个单据往往有录入人和审批人,录入人具有增、删、该、查的权限;而审批人具有审批、反审批和
# 数据权限规则的抽象:Java类实现 在现代应用程序中,数据的安全和隐私越来越受到重视。如何有效地管理和控制数据的访问权限,成为了软件工程师面临的一项重要任务。本篇文章将讲解怎样将数据权限规则抽象成Java类,并提供相应的代码示例,以帮助读者更好地理解这一概念。 ## 什么是数据权限规则 数据权限规则是对谁可以访问什么数据或执行哪些操作的定义。常见的场景包括:用户角色的管理、细粒度的数据
原创 2024-09-11 03:54:36
21阅读
实验01:ALP规则的验证实验目标:创建本地用户jack、tom、mike,创建本地组group1,并把以上所建用户加入到group1组,通过ALP规则实现以上用户对d:\share\01.txt文件内容读取和写入权限。group2组的用户拒绝访问此文件实验环境:Windows Server 2008环境实验步骤:  一、启动Windows Server 2008系统虚拟机 &
原创 2014-08-30 00:56:23
986阅读
http://shine-it.net/index.php/topic,7321.msg16741.html#msg16741 http://shine-it.net/index.php/topic,16342.msg27898.html#msg27898 http://blog.sina.com.cn/s/blog_7cb52fa80101lflr.html htt
转载 精选 2014-11-29 00:00:07
396阅读
r=4,w=2,x=1 因此 rwx=4+2+1=7 也就是 文件者 所属组 其他人 每个列的最大权限就是7 拥有最大权限为 rwx rwx rwx 也就是777。+表示这三者皆是。
 前面写了博客聊聊数据权限哪些事儿,实际上在写那篇文章的时候,思路就已经思考好了,然后就是代码实现了。相对于解决方案,代码简直就太容易了。首先说说功能特性 数据权限--让不同的人看到不同的数据行的权限控制数据权限--对使用者限制其访问其些列或某些列中的数据权限控制 数据权限说起来比较简单,但是实际实现过程中,也是非常复杂的,比如,同样是select表,可能是对原样的表名及字段名进行
转载 2023-08-24 14:56:11
136阅读
之前简单的记录了一下java的注解使用及解析java注解简述及自定义注解的简单使用,但是纸上谈兵终究不是程序员擅长的事,今天记录一下常见的权限系统使用注解实现的逻辑归根结底,权限限制就是对比当前用户所持有的权限身份以及他即将执行的动作所需要的权限,若两者匹配,则执行逻辑,若不匹配,则返回提示。所以这里实际上只需要的两个重要参数,一个是用户持有的权限,一个是执行所需的权限。 执行权限是系统持有的,可
转载 2023-10-21 23:40:48
5阅读
java计算机毕业设计权限办公用具采购管理源码+系统+mysql数据库+lw文档+部署 java计算机毕业设计权限办公用具采购管理源码+系统+mysql数据库+lw文档+部署 本源码技术栈:项目架构:B/S架构开发语言:Java语言开发软件:idea eclipse前端技术:Layui、HTML、CSS、JS、JQuery等技术后端技术:JAVA运行环境:Win10、JDK1.8数 据 库:
最近在做公司内部的物流业务平台的权限管理,感触颇多。记录一下  权限管理分两部分:数据权限和操作权限。  数据权限:    这个是和用户相关的。    因为平台是多机构的,所以再考虑数据权限的时候,是按照机构来管理的,每个机构下对应的人员,只能查看到自己有权限的机构下的数据。  操作权限:    这个是和角色相关的。    每个用户登录进去,只能看到自己对应角色的菜单,每一次点击按钮,也会校验有没
转载 2023-06-13 19:56:48
479阅读
## 简介 java中4种访问权限修饰符分别为public、protect、default、private,他们这就说明了面向对象的封装性,所以我们要适用他们尽可能的让权限降到最低,从而安全性提高。概况首先在这里把它们的访问权限表示出来: 访问权限 类 包 子类 其他包 public ∨ ∨ ∨ ∨ protect ∨ ∨ ∨ ×
# 数据清洗规则Java实现 在数据分析的过程中,数据清洗是必不可少的一步。无论是面对电子表格、数据库,还是大数据集,脏数据都对结果产生负面影响。因此,了解数据清洗规则并掌握相应工具非常重要。本文将以Java为例讲解数据清洗的基本规则,并展示一些具体的代码示例。 ## 数据清洗的主要规则 数据清洗主要包括以下几个方面: 1. **去除重复数据**:删除在数据集中重复出现的记录,以减少冗余
原创 2024-11-01 03:50:43
37阅读
8.权限管理1.用户的权限用户的权限:指的是一个数据库用户可以对数据进行操作的能力,最简单的例子是:能飞对表进行增删改查等操作。调用的数据库:MySQL中的User表格。本质:对MySQL.User进行增删改查。(1)查看数据库中的用户数据use mysql; select * from user;(2)创建新的用户:-- 创建用户:create user 用户名 identified by '
基于SpringAOP实现数据权限控制在此主要是实现对用户查询数据返回字段的控制。比如一个表格有A,B,C,D,E五列,用户U1只能查看A,B,C三列。此文章讲述的内容并不能实现在查询时仅查询A,B,C三列,而是在查询后做过滤,将D,E两列的值置为空。本文只启到抛砖引玉的作用,代码并没有完全实现。只写了核心部分。如果大家用到的话,还需要根据自己项目的权限体系完善。准备工作首先定义注解QueryMe
转载 2023-12-16 06:35:17
249阅读
目录:1、源文件命名规则2、Java与c++区别3、标识符命名4、数据类型5、continue、break语句6、数组(一)Java源文件命名规则1、Java 程序源文件的后缀必须是 .java,不能是其他文件后缀名。2、如果 Java 程序源代码里定义了一个 public 类,则该源文件的主文件名必须与该 public 类的类名相同。3、如果 Java 程序源代码里没有定义 public 类,那
### 实现 Java 数据权限 对于一个刚入行的开发者来说,实现 Java 数据权限可能是一项相对复杂的任务。但是,只要掌握了相应的步骤和代码,就能够轻松地完成这个任务。 下面是实现 Java 数据权限的步骤: | 步骤 | 描述 | | --- | --- | | 步骤一 | 定义用户角色和权限 | | 步骤二 | 实现权限验证 | | 步骤三 | 实现数据权限过滤 | 接下来,让我们
原创 2023-07-16 06:59:05
159阅读
## 数据权限Java科普 在软件开发领域,数据权限是指对数据访问进行控制的一种机制,以保护数据的安全性和隐私。在Java开发中,数据权限管理是一个重要的话题。在本文中,我们将介绍数据权限Java中的实现方法,并提供代码示例。 ### 数据权限概述 数据权限是指规定谁可以访问哪些数据,在什么条件下可以访问数据的安全控制机制。通常情况下,数据权限是根据用户的角色或权限级别进行控制的。在Jav
原创 2024-05-14 04:44:48
99阅读
1.进行访问权限控制的原因:(1)是防止用户接触那些他们不应碰的工具。对于数据类型的内部机制,那些工具是必需的。但它们并不属于用户接口的一部分,用户不必用它来解决自己的特定问题。所以将方法和字段变成“私有”(private)后,可极大方便用户。因为他们能轻易看出哪些对于自己来说是最重要的,以及哪些是自己需要忽略的。这样便简化了用户对一个类的理解。(2)允许库设计者改变类的内部工作机制,同时不必担心
转载 2023-09-26 11:33:53
196阅读
第三天实验01   ALP规则的验证实验目标:创建本地用户jack、tom、mike,创建本地组group1,并把以上所建用户加入到group1组,通过ALP规则实现以上用户对d:\share\01.txt文件内容读取和写入权限,group2组的用户拒绝访问此文件实验环境:Windows  server  2008 系
原创 精选 2014-08-11 21:49:20
1282阅读
java中的访问权限:public、protected、包访问权限、private 这是非常熟悉的,因为都知道,java中的封装是指将数据和方法包装进类中,并且赋予合适的访问控制类中的数据,方法均含有上述访问权限控制,同时类也是含有访问权限控制类的访问权限控制只有包访问权限和public权限,不含protected和private权限在没有声明package的类的访问权限默认为包访问权限
转载 2023-06-28 16:15:43
49阅读
  • 1
  • 2
  • 3
  • 4
  • 5